Fluorescence Assay by Supersonic Gas Expansion (FAGE-HOx)

Atmospheric gas detection

This project develops a new aircraft Fluorescence Assay by supersonic Gas Expansion (FAGE) instrument for detecting atmospheric gases, using the original FAGE inlet. The upgraded FAGE instrument will be three times as sensitive. The UV laser power that this new system can provide is considerably greater than was achieved with the previous laser. OH reactivity will be measured simultaneously using laser flash photolysis laser-induced fluorescence, meaning that OH reactivity can be measured in real time.
